2006-10-30[NetLabel]: protect the CIPSOv4 socket option from setsockopt()Paul Moore3-1/+54
This patch makes two changes to protect applications from either removing or tampering with the CIPSOv4 IP option on a socket. The first is the requirement that applications have the CAP_NET_RAW capability to set an IPOPT_CIPSO option on a socket; this prevents untrusted applications from setting their own CIPSOv4 security attributes on the packets they send. The second change is to SELinux and it prevents applications from setting any IPv4 options when there is an IPOPT_CIPSO option already present on the socket; this prevents applications from removing CIPSOv4 security attributes from the packets they send. 2006-10-11SELinux: Bug fix in polidydb_destroyChad Sellers1-0/+2
This patch fixes two bugs in policydb_destroy. Two list pointers (policydb.ocontexts[i] and policydb.genfs) were not being reset to NULL when the lists they pointed to were being freed. This caused a problem when the initial policy load failed, as the policydb being destroyed was not a temporary new policydb that was thrown away, but rather was the global (active) policydb. Consequently, later functions, particularly sys_bind->selinux_socket_bind->security_node_sid and do_rw_proc->selinux_sysctl->selinux_proc_get_sid->security_genfs_sid tried to dereference memory that had previously been freed. 2006-10-11IPsec: correct semantics for SELinux policy matchingVenkat Yekkirala3-14/+45
Currently when an IPSec policy rule doesn't specify a security context, it is assumed to be "unlabeled" by SELinux, and so the IPSec policy rule fails to match to a flow that it would otherwise match to, unless one has explicitly added an SELinux policy rule allowing the flow to "polmatch" to the "unlabeled" IPSec policy rules. In the absence of such an explicitly added SELinux policy rule, the IPSec policy rule fails to match and so the packet(s) flow in clear text without the otherwise applicable xfrm(s) applied. The above SELinux behavior violates the SELinux security notion of "deny by default" which should actually translate to "encrypt by default" in the above case. This was first reported by Evgeniy Polyakov and the way James Morris was seeing the problem was when connecting via IPsec to a confined service on an SELinux box (vsftpd), which did not have the appropriate SELinux policy permissions to send packets via IPsec. With this patch applied, SELinux "polmatching" of flows Vs. IPSec policy rules will only come into play when there's a explicit context specified for the IPSec policy rule (which also means there's corresponding SELinux policy allowing appropriate domains/flows to polmatch to this context). Secondly, when a security module is loaded (in this case, SELinux), the security_xfrm_policy_lookup() hook can return errors other than access denied, such as -EINVAL. We were not handling that correctly, and in fact inverting the return logic and propagating a false "ok" back up to xfrm_lookup(), which then allowed packets to pass as if they were not associated with an xfrm policy. The solution for this is to first ensure that errno values are correctly propagated all the way back up through the various call chains from security_xfrm_policy_lookup(), and handled correctly. Then, flow_cache_lookup() is modified, so that if the policy resolver fails (typically a permission denied via the security module), the flow cache entry is killed rather than having a null policy assigned (which indicates that the packet can pass freely). This also forces any future lookups for the same flow to consult the security module (e.g. SELinux) for current security policy (rather than, say, caching the error on the flow cache entry). This patch: Fix the selinux side of things. This makes sure SELinux polmatching of flow contexts to IPSec policy rules comes into play only when an explicit context is associated with the IPSec policy rule. Also, this no longer defaults the context of a socket policy to the context of the socket since the "no explicit context" case is now handled properly. 2006-09-29[PATCH] SELinux: support mls categories for context mountsCory Olmo1-5/+30
Allows commas to be embedded into context mount options (i.e. "-o context=some_selinux_context_t"), to better support multiple categories, which are separated by commas and confuse mount. For example, with the current code: mount -t iso9660 /dev/cdrom /media/cdrom -o \ ro,context=system_u:object_r:iso9660_t:s0:c1,c3,c4,exec The context option that will be interpreted by SELinux is context=system_u:object_r:iso9660_t:s0:c1 instead of context=system_u:object_r:iso9660_t:s0:c1,c3,c4 The options that will be passed on to the file system will be ro,c3,c4,exec. The proposed solution is to allow/require the SELinux context option specified to mount to use quotes when the context contains a comma. This patch modifies the option parsing in parse_opts(), contained in mount.c, to take options after finding a comma only if it hasn't seen a quote or if the quotes are matched. It also introduces a new function that will strip the quotes from the context option prior to translation. The quotes are replaced after the translation is completed to insure that in the event the raw context contains commas the kernel will be able to interpret the correct context. 2006-09-22[NetLabel]: SELinux supportVenkat Yekkirala9-14/+996
Add NetLabel support to the SELinux LSM and modify the socket_post_create() LSM hook to return an error code. The most significant part of this patch is the addition of NetLabel hooks into the following SELinux LSM hooks: * selinux_file_permission() * selinux_socket_sendmsg() * selinux_socket_post_create() * selinux_socket_sock_rcv_skb() * selinux_socket_getpeersec_stream() * selinux_socket_getpeersec_dgram() * selinux_sock_graft() * selinux_inet_conn_request() The basic reasoning behind this patch is that outgoing packets are "NetLabel'd" by labeling their socket and the NetLabel security attributes are checked via the additional hook in selinux_socket_sock_rcv_skb(). NetLabel itself is only a labeling mechanism, similar to filesystem extended attributes, it is up to the SELinux enforcement mechanism to perform the actual access checks. In addition to the changes outlined above this patch also includes some changes to the extended bitmap (ebitmap) and multi-level security (mls) code to import and export SELinux TE/MLS attributes into and out of NetLabel. 2006-09-22[MLSXFRM]: Granular IPSec associations for use in MLS environmentsVenkat Yekkirala2-0/+2
The current approach to labeling Security Associations for SELinux purposes uses a one-to-one mapping between xfrm policy rules and security associations. This doesn't address the needs of real world MLS (Multi-level System, traditional Bell-LaPadula) environments where a single xfrm policy rule (pertaining to a range, classified to secret for example) might need to map to multiple Security Associations (one each for classified, secret, top secret and all the compartments applicable to these security levels). This patch set addresses the above problem by allowing for the mapping of a single xfrm policy rule to multiple security associations, with each association used in the security context it is defined for. It also includes the security context to be used in IKE negotiation in the acquire messages sent to the IKE daemon so that a unique SA can be negotiated for each unique security context. A couple of bug fixes are also included; checks to make sure the SAs used by a packet match policy (security context-wise) on the inbound and also that the bundle used for the outbound matches the security context of the flow. This patch set also makes the use of the SELinux sid in flow cache lookups seemless by including the sid in the flow key itself. Also, open requests as well as connection-oriented child sockets are labeled automatically to be at the same level as the peer to allow for use of appropriately labeled IPSec associations. Description of changes: A "sid" member has been added to the flow cache key resulting in the sid being available at all needed locations and the flow cache lookups automatically using the sid. The flow sid is derived from the socket on the outbound and the SAs (unlabeled where an SA was not used) on the inbound. Outbound case: 1. Find policy for the socket. 2. OLD: Find an SA that matches the policy. NEW: Find an SA that matches BOTH the policy and the flow/socket. This is necessary since not every SA that matches the policy can be used for the flow/socket. Consider policy range Secret-TS, and SAs each for Secret and TS. We don't want a TS socket to use the Secret SA. Hence the additional check for the SA Vs. flow/socket. 3. NEW: When looking thru bundles for a policy, make sure the flow/socket can use the bundle. If a bundle is not found, create one, calling for IKE if necessary. If using IKE, include the security context in the acquire message to the IKE daemon. Inbound case: 1. OLD: Find policy for the socket. NEW: Find policy for the incoming packet based on the sid of the SA(s) it used or the unlabeled sid if no SAs were used. (Consider a case where a socket is "authorized" for two policies (unclassified-confidential, secret-top_secret). If the packet has come in using a secret SA, we really ought to be using the latter policy (secret-top_secret).) 2. OLD: BUG: No check to see if the SAs used by the packet agree with the policy sec_ctx-wise. (It was indicated in selinux_xfrm_sock_rcv_skb() that this was being accomplished by (x->id.spi == tmpl->id.spi || !tmpl->id.spi) in xfrm_state_ok, but it turns out tmpl->id.spi would normally be zero (unless xfrm policy rules specify one at the template level, which they usually don't). NEW: The socket is checked for access to the SAs used (based on the sid of the SAs) in selinux_xfrm_sock_rcv_skb(). Forward case: This would be Step 1 from the Inbound case, followed by Steps 2 and 3 from the Outbound case. Outstanding items/issues: - Timewait acknowledgements and such are generated in the current/upstream implementation using a NULL socket resulting in the any_socket sid (SYSTEM_HIGH) to be used. This problem is not addressed by this patch set. This patch: Add new flask definitions to SELinux Adds a new avperm "polmatch" to arbitrate flow/state access to a xfrm policy rule. 2006-06-29[AF_UNIX]: Datagram getpeersecCatherine Zhang1-3/+8
This patch implements an API whereby an application can determine the label of its peer's Unix datagram sockets via the auxiliary data mechanism of recvmsg. Patch purpose: This patch enables a security-aware application to retrieve the security context of the peer of a Unix datagram socket. The application can then use this security context to determine the security context for processing on behalf of the peer who sent the packet. Patch design and implementation: The design and implementation is very similar to the UDP case for INET sockets. Basically we build upon the existing Unix domain socket API for retrieving user credentials. Linux offers the API for obtaining user credentials via ancillary messages (i.e., out of band/control messages that are bundled together with a normal message). To retrieve the security context, the application first indicates to the kernel such desire by setting the SO_PASSSEC option via getsockopt. Then the application retrieves the security context using the auxiliary data mechanism. An example server application for Unix datagram socket should look like this: toggle = 1; toggle_len = sizeof(toggle); setsockopt(sockfd, SOL_SOCKET, SO_PASSSEC, &toggle, &toggle_len); recvmsg(sockfd, &msg_hdr, 0); if (msg_hdr.msg_controllen > sizeof(struct cmsghdr)) { cmsg_hdr = CMSG_FIRSTHDR(&msg_hdr); if (cmsg_hdr->cmsg_len <= CMSG_LEN(sizeof(scontext)) && cmsg_hdr->cmsg_level == SOL_SOCKET && cmsg_hdr->cmsg_type == SCM_SECURITY) { memcpy(&scontext, CMSG_DATA(cmsg_hdr), sizeof(scontext)); } } sock_setsockopt is enhanced with a new socket option SOCK_PASSSEC to allow a server socket to receive security context of the peer. Testing: We have tested the patch by setting up Unix datagram client and server applications. We verified that the server can retrieve the security context using the auxiliary data mechanism of recvmsg. 2006-06-26[PATCH] keys: allocate key serial numbers randomlyMichael LeMay1-14/+14
Cause key_alloc_serial() to generate key serial numbers randomly rather than in linear sequence. Using an linear sequence permits a covert communication channel to be established, in which one process can communicate with another by creating or not creating new keys within a certain timeframe. The second process can probe for the expected next key serial number and judge its existence by the error returned. This is a problem as the serial number namespace is globally shared between all tasks, regardless of their context. 2006-06-23[PATCH] VFS: Permit filesystem to override root dentry on mountDavid Howells2-7/+8
Extend the get_sb() filesystem operation to take an extra argument that permits the VFS to pass in the target vfsmount that defines the mountpoint. The filesystem is then required to manually set the superblock and root dentry pointers. For most filesystems, this should be done with simple_set_mnt() which will set the superblock pointer and then set the root dentry to the superblock's s_root (as per the old default behaviour). The get_sb() op now returns an integer as there's now no need to return the superblock pointer. This patch permits a superblock to be implicitly shared amongst several mount points, such as can be done with NFS to avoid potential inode aliasing. In such a case, simple_set_mnt() would not be called, and instead the mnt_root and mnt_sb would be set directly. The patch also makes the following changes: (*) the get_sb_*() convenience functions in the core kernel now take a vfsmount pointer argument and return an integer, so most filesystems have to change very little. (*) If one of the convenience function is not used, then get_sb() should normally call simple_set_mnt() to instantiate the vfsmount. This will always return 0, and so can be tail-called from get_sb(). (*) generic_shutdown_super() now calls shrink_dcache_sb() to clean up the dcache upon superblock destruction rather than shrink_dcache_anon(). This is required because the superblock may now have multiple trees that aren't actually bound to s_root, but that still need to be cleaned up. The currently called functions assume that the whole tree is rooted at s_root, and that anonymous dentries are not the roots of trees which results in dentries being left unculled. However, with the way NFS superblock sharing are currently set to be implemented, these assumptions are violated: the root of the filesystem is simply a dummy dentry and inode (the real inode for '/' may well be inaccessible), and all the vfsmounts are rooted on anonymous[*] dentries with child trees. [*] Anonymous until discovered from another tree. (*) The documentation has been adjusted, including the additional bit of changing ext2_* into foo_* in the documentation. 2006-06-17[SECMARK]: Add new packet controls to SELinuxJames Morris5-119/+232
Add new per-packet access controls to SELinux, replacing the old packet controls. Packets are labeled with the iptables SECMARK and CONNSECMARK targets, then security policy for the packets is enforced with these controls. To allow for a smooth transition to the new controls, the old code is still present, but not active by default. To restore previous behavior, the old controls may be activated at runtime by writing a '1' to /selinux/compat_net, and also via the kernel boot parameter selinux_compat_net. Switching between the network control models requires the security load_policy permission. The old controls will probably eventually be removed and any continued use is discouraged. With this patch, the new secmark controls for SElinux are disabled by default, so existing behavior is entirely preserved, and the user is not affected at all. It also provides a config option to enable the secmark controls by default (which can always be overridden at boot and runtime). It is also noted in the kconfig help that the user will need updated userspace if enabling secmark controls for SELinux and that they'll probably need the SECMARK and CONNMARK targets, and conntrack protocol helpers, although such decisions are beyond the scope of kernel configuration. 2006-06-17[LSM-IPsec]: SELinux AuthorizeCatherine Zhang4-4/+51
This patch contains a fix for the previous patch that adds security contexts to IPsec policies and security associations. In the previous patch, no authorization (besides the check for write permissions to SAD and SPD) is required to delete IPsec policies and security assocations with security contexts. Thus a user authorized to change SAD and SPD can bypass the IPsec policy authorization by simply deleteing policies with security contexts. To fix this security hole, an additional authorization check is added for removing security policies and security associations with security contexts. Note that if no security context is supplied on add or present on policy to be deleted, the SELinux module allows the change unconditionally. The hook is called on deletion when no context is present, which we may want to change. At present, I left it up to the module. LSM changes: The patch adds two new LSM hooks: xfrm_policy_delete and xfrm_state_delete. The new hooks are necessary to authorize deletion of IPsec policies that have security contexts. The existing hooks xfrm_policy_free and xfrm_state_free lack the context to do the authorization, so I decided to split authorization of deletion and memory management of security data, as is typical in the LSM interface. Use: The new delete hooks are checked when xfrm_policy or xfrm_state are deleted by either the xfrm_user interface (xfrm_get_policy, xfrm_del_sa) or the pfkey interface (pfkey_spddelete, pfkey_delete). SELinux changes: The new policy_delete and state_delete functions are added. 2006-03-20[SECURITY]: TCP/UDP getpeersecCatherine Zhang4-9/+117
This patch implements an application of the LSM-IPSec networking controls whereby an application can determine the label of the security association its TCP or UDP sockets are currently connected to via getsockopt and the auxiliary data mechanism of recvmsg. Patch purpose: This patch enables a security-aware application to retrieve the security context of an IPSec security association a particular TCP or UDP socket is using. The application can then use this security context to determine the security context for processing on behalf of the peer at the other end of this connection. In the case of UDP, the security context is for each individual packet. An example application is the inetd daemon, which could be modified to start daemons running at security contexts dependent on the remote client. Patch design approach: - Design for TCP The patch enables the SELinux LSM to set the peer security context for a socket based on the security context of the IPSec security association. The application may retrieve this context using getsockopt. When called, the kernel determines if the socket is a connected (TCP_ESTABLISHED) TCP socket and, if so, uses the dst_entry cache on the socket to retrieve the security associations. If a security association has a security context, the context string is returned, as for UNIX domain sockets. - Design for UDP Unlike TCP, UDP is connectionless. This requires a somewhat different API to retrieve the peer security context. With TCP, the peer security context stays the same throughout the connection, thus it can be retrieved at any time between when the connection is established and when it is torn down. With UDP, each read/write can have different peer and thus the security context might change every time. As a result the security context retrieval must be done TOGETHER with the packet retrieval. The solution is to build upon the existing Unix domain socket API for retrieving user credentials. Linux offers the API for obtaining user credentials via ancillary messages (i.e., out of band/control messages that are bundled together with a normal message). Patch implementation details: - Implementation for TCP The security context can be retrieved by applications using getsockopt with the existing SO_PEERSEC flag. As an example (ignoring error checking): getsockopt(sockfd, SOL_SOCKET, SO_PEERSEC, optbuf, &optlen); printf("Socket peer context is: %s\n", optbuf); The SELinux function, selinux_socket_getpeersec, is extended to check for labeled security associations for connected (TCP_ESTABLISHED == sk->sk_state) TCP sockets only. If so, the socket has a dst_cache of struct dst_entry values that may refer to security associations. If these have security associations with security contexts, the security context is returned. getsockopt returns a buffer that contains a security context string or the buffer is unmodified. - Implementation for UDP To retrieve the security context, the application first indicates to the kernel such desire by setting the IP_PASSSEC option via getsockopt. Then the application retrieves the security context using the auxiliary data mechanism. An example server application for UDP should look like this: toggle = 1; toggle_len = sizeof(toggle); setsockopt(sockfd, SOL_IP, IP_PASSSEC, &toggle, &toggle_len); recvmsg(sockfd, &msg_hdr, 0); if (msg_hdr.msg_controllen > sizeof(struct cmsghdr)) { cmsg_hdr = CMSG_FIRSTHDR(&msg_hdr); if (cmsg_hdr->cmsg_len <= CMSG_LEN(sizeof(scontext)) && cmsg_hdr->cmsg_level == SOL_IP && cmsg_hdr->cmsg_type == SCM_SECURITY) { memcpy(&scontext, CMSG_DATA(cmsg_hdr), sizeof(scontext)); } } ip_setsockopt is enhanced with a new socket option IP_PASSSEC to allow a server socket to receive security context of the peer. A new ancillary message type SCM_SECURITY. When the packet is received we get the security context from the sec_path pointer which is contained in the sk_buff, and copy it to the ancillary message space. An additional LSM hook, selinux_socket_getpeersec_udp, is defined to retrieve the security context from the SELinux space. The existing function, selinux_socket_getpeersec does not suit our purpose, because the security context is copied directly to user space, rather than to kernel space. Testing: We have tested the patch by setting up TCP and UDP connections between applications on two machines using the IPSec policies that result in labeled security associations being built. For TCP, we can then extract the peer security context using getsockopt on either end. For UDP, the receiving end can retrieve the security context using the auxiliary data mechanism of recvmsg. 2006-01-08[PATCH] shrink dentry structEric Dumazet1-1/+1
Some long time ago, dentry struct was carefully tuned so that on 32 bits UP, sizeof(struct dentry) was exactly 128, ie a power of 2, and a multiple of memory cache lines. Then RCU was added and dentry struct enlarged by two pointers, with nice results for SMP, but not so good on UP, because breaking the above tuning (128 + 8 = 136 bytes) This patch reverts this unwanted side effect, by using an union (d_u), where d_rcu and d_child are placed so that these two fields can share their memory needs. At the time d_free() is called (and d_rcu is really used), d_child is known to be empty and not touched by the dentry freeing. Lockless lookups only access d_name, d_parent, d_lock, d_op, d_flags (so the previous content of d_child is not needed if said dentry was unhashed but still accessed by a CPU because of RCU constraints) As dentry cache easily contains millions of entries, a size reduction is worth the extra complexity of the ugly C union. 2006-01-03[LSM-IPSec]: Per-packet access control.Trent Jaeger6-0/+410
This patch series implements per packet access control via the extension of the Linux Security Modules (LSM) interface by hooks in the XFRM and pfkey subsystems that leverage IPSec security associations to label packets. Extensions to the SELinux LSM are included that leverage the patch for this purpose. This patch implements the changes necessary to the SELinux LSM to create, deallocate, and use security contexts for policies (xfrm_policy) and security associations (xfrm_state) that enable control of a socket's ability to send and receive packets. Patch purpose: The patch is designed to enable the SELinux LSM to implement access control on individual packets based on the strongly authenticated IPSec security association. Such access controls augment the existing ones in SELinux based on network interface and IP address. The former are very coarse-grained, and the latter can be spoofed. By using IPSec, the SELinux can control access to remote hosts based on cryptographic keys generated using the IPSec mechanism. This enables access control on a per-machine basis or per-application if the remote machine is running the same mechanism and trusted to enforce the access control policy. Patch design approach: The patch's main function is to authorize a socket's access to a IPSec policy based on their security contexts. Since the communication is implemented by a security association, the patch ensures that the security association's negotiated and used have the same security context. The patch enables allocation and deallocation of such security contexts for policies and security associations. It also enables copying of the security context when policies are cloned. Lastly, the patch ensures that packets that are sent without using a IPSec security assocation with a security context are allowed to be sent in that manner. A presentation available at www.selinux-symposium.org/2005/presentations/session2/2-3-jaeger.pdf from the SELinux symposium describes the overall approach. Patch implementation details: The function which authorizes a socket to perform a requested operation (send/receive) on a IPSec policy (xfrm_policy) is selinux_xfrm_policy_lookup. The Netfilter and rcv_skb hooks ensure that if a IPSec SA with a securit y association has not been used, then the socket is allowed to send or receive the packet, respectively. The patch implements SELinux function for allocating security contexts when policies (xfrm_policy) are created via the pfkey or xfrm_user interfaces via selinux_xfrm_policy_alloc. When a security association is built, SELinux allocates the security context designated by the XFRM subsystem which is based on that of the authorized policy via selinux_xfrm_state_alloc. When a xfrm_policy is cloned, the security context of that policy, if any, is copied to the clone via selinux_xfrm_policy_clone. When a xfrm_policy or xfrm_state is freed, its security context, if any is also freed at selinux_xfrm_policy_free or selinux_xfrm_state_free. Testing: The SELinux authorization function is tested using ipsec-tools. We created policies and security associations with particular security contexts and added SELinux access control policy entries to verify the authorization decision. We also made sure that packets for which no security context was supplied (which either did or did not use security associations) were authorized using an unlabelled context. 2005-09-30[PATCH] SELinux - fix SCTP socket bug and general IP protocol handlingJames Morris1-6/+24
The following patch updates the way SELinux classifies and handles IP based protocols. Currently, IP sockets are classified by SELinux as being either TCP, UDP or 'Raw', the latter being a default for IP socket that is not TCP or UDP. The classification code is out of date and uses only the socket type parameter to socket(2) to determine the class of IP socket. So, any socket created with SOCK_STREAM will be classified by SELinux as TCP, and SOCK_DGRAM as UDP. Also, other socket types such as SOCK_SEQPACKET and SOCK_DCCP are currently ignored by SELinux, which classifies them as generic sockets, which means they don't even get basic IP level checking. This patch changes the SELinux IP socket classification logic, so that only an IPPROTO_IP protocol value passed to socket(2) classify the socket as TCP or UDP. The patch also drops the check for SOCK_RAW and converts it into a default, so that socket types like SOCK_DCCP and SOCK_SEQPACKET are classified as SECCLASS_RAWIP_SOCKET (instead of generic sockets). Note that protocol-specific support for SCTP, DCCP etc. is not addressed here, we're just getting these protocols checked at the IP layer. This fixes a reported problem where SCTP sockets were being recognized as generic SELinux sockets yet still being passed in one case to an IP level check, which then fails for generic sockets. It will also fix bugs where any SOCK_STREAM socket is classified as TCP or any SOCK_DGRAM socket is classified as UDP. This patch also unifies the way IP sockets classes are determined in selinux_socket_bind(), so we use the already calculated value instead of trying to recalculate it. 2005-09-09[PATCH] security: enable atomic inode security labelingStephen Smalley3-0/+67
The following patch set enables atomic security labeling of newly created inodes by altering the fs code to invoke a new LSM hook to obtain the security attribute to apply to a newly created inode and to set up the incore inode security state during the inode creation transaction. This parallels the existing processing for setting ACLs on newly created inodes. Otherwise, it is possible for new inodes to be accessed by another thread via the dcache prior to complete security setup (presently handled by the post_create/mkdir/... LSM hooks in the VFS) and a newly created inode may be left unlabeled on the disk in the event of a crash. SELinux presently works around the issue by ensuring that the incore inode security label is initialized to a special SID that is inaccessible to unprivileged processes (in accordance with policy), thereby preventing inappropriate access but potentially causing false denials on legitimate accesses. A simple test program demonstrates such false denials on SELinux, and the patch solves the problem. Similar such false denials have been encountered in real applications. This patch defines a new inode_init_security LSM hook to obtain the security attribute to apply to a newly created inode and to set up the incore inode security state for it, and adds a corresponding hook function implementation to SELinux. 2005-09-05[PATCH] selinux: Reduce memory use by avtabStephen Smalley9-235/+400
This patch improves memory use by SELinux by both reducing the avtab node size and reducing the number of avtab nodes. The memory savings are substantial, e.g. on a 64-bit system after boot, James Morris reported the following data for the targeted and strict policies: #objs objsize kernmem Targeted: Before: 237888 40 9.1MB After: 19968 24 468KB Strict: Before: 571680 40 21.81MB After: 221052 24 5.06MB The improvement in memory use comes at a cost in the speed of security server computations of access vectors, but these computations are only required on AVC cache misses, and performance measurements by James Morris using a number of benchmarks have shown that the change does not cause any significant degradation. Note that a rebuilt policy via an updated policy toolchain (libsepol/checkpolicy) is required in order to gain the full benefits of this patch, although some memory savings benefits are immediately applied even to older policies (in particular, the reduction in avtab node size). 2005-08-04[PATCH] Destruction of failed keyring oopsesDavid Howells1-1/+5
The attached patch makes sure that a keyring that failed to instantiate properly is destroyed without oopsing [CAN-2005-2099]. The problem occurs in three stages: (1) The key allocator initialises the type-specific data to all zeroes. In the case of a keyring, this will become a link in the keyring name list when the keyring is instantiated. (2) If a user (any user) attempts to add a keyring with anything other than an empty payload, the keyring instantiation function will fail with an error and won't add the keyring to the name list. (3) The keyring's destructor then sees that the keyring has a description (name) and tries to remove the keyring from the name list, which oopses because the link pointers are both zero. This bug permits any user to take down a box trivially.
